Output 525d64cda1c27456f6f7323748df2dd4e223fb15ceb359d5facb70624f00a8fd:3

value
3885750
script pubkey
OP_0 OP_PUSHBYTES_20 43c37d62bad0a526ce33ff85d1d25d03823912fa
address
bc1qg0ph6c466zjjdn3nl7zar5jaqwprjyh6jxqzvz
transaction
525d64cda1c27456f6f7323748df2dd4e223fb15ceb359d5facb70624f00a8fd
confirmations
149800
spent
true